#687abb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#687abb is composed of 40.8% red, 47.8%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 34.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 227 degrees, a saturation of 37.9% and a lightness of 57.1%. #687abb color hex could be obtained by blending #d0f4ff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#687abb color description : Slightly desaturated blue.

#687abb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#687abb has RGB values of R:104, G:122,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 6847163.

Shades and Tints of #687abb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05060b is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#687abb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8d99 is the less saturated color, while #2554fe is the most saturated one.
